About UsCounty of Inverness Municipal Housing Corporation (CIMHC) is a Not-for-Profit Corporation under the authority of the Municipality of the County of Inverness. The Corporation is comprised of four (4) separate entities: two (2) Long Term Care Homes; Inverary Manor, (located in Inverness, NS) and Foyer Père Fiset (located in Cheticamp, NS) and two (2) Small Option Homes; Koster Huis (Mabou, NS) and Port Hood Small Options (Port Hood, NS).
